Robotics & Automation Integration in Nextgen Technologies

Collaborative robots, also known as cobots, work side by side with people in factories to boost speed and accuracy. These friendly machines can lift and place materials carefully, so workers have more time for creative work. Picture a lightweight robotic arm picking up a part while a technician checks its quality. This blend of human insight and mechanical skill is reshaping how factories operate.
Another important tool in modern manufacturing is the autonomous guided system. These self-driving units move around the factory using sensors (devices that detect objects) and mapping technology. They handle tasks like moving materials from one station to another by finding the best routes, which cuts downtime and errors. So, when you see a cart moving on its own, think of it as a tireless helper keeping the production line running smoothly.

Advanced Battery & Energy Storage Innovations for Nextgen Technologies
New types of batteries, like solid-state and lithium-sulfur, are changing how we store energy. Solid-state batteries use hard materials instead of liquids, which helps prevent leaks and makes them safer. Lithium-sulfur batteries are lighter and pack more energy, making them perfect for devices that need both power and portability. These breakthroughs are setting a higher bar for battery performance and care for our planet.
These improved battery designs also charge faster and last longer. They help keep heat in check and work more efficiently every day. With materials that transfer energy quickly and endure many charge cycles, these batteries are changing how our gadgets and vehicles use power. In short, our energy storage is getting more efficient and dependable.

Blockchain Evolution & Security Features in Nextgen Technologies

Blockchain started out as a simple open ledger that anyone could use. Over time, as people wanted more privacy and faster processing, it evolved into a system where only trusted members can add or verify records. This change means companies can now count on blockchain to keep things secure and speedy in modern tech setups.
Today, blockchain uses strong security methods to protect sensitive information. For example, smart-contract auditing (a step-by-step check of automatic agreements) makes sure self-running codes do what they should without loopholes. Plus, zero-knowledge proofs (a way for one party to show they know something without revealing the actual details) add extra trust. Together, these features help keep transactions safe even as the system runs smoothly.
